I forbindelse med utbygging, er det gjennomført arkeologiske undersøkelser på Husbyåsen i Stjørdal. Undersøkelsen (flateavdekkingen) i området brakte frem i lyset spor en bosetning som vi antar er fra bronsealder og muligens tilbake til yngre steinalder. Sporene besto av restene etter to treskipede hus, et toskipet hus og en konstruksjon i tilknytning til den ene åkerholmen. I tillegg var det ildsteder, kokegroper og avfallsgroper på boplassen. I det hele dreier det seg om en åkerholme med nær 100 skålgroper, en åkerholme med tre fotsåler og noen skålgroper, en bergflate med tre svake båtfigurer og en bergflate med tre klare båtfigurer. |

English: In connection with the construction of an addition on a building, an archeological field survey was conducted at Husbyåsen, Stjørdal.
The field survey found a settlement, probably from the bronze age and possibly even as far back as the early stone age. The findings consisted of the remains of two three aisled houses, one one aisled house, and a construction linked with a field islet. The settlement also contained hearths, earth ovens and landfills. Overall, the survey unveiled two field islets, of which contained close to 100 cup marks, and one with three foot sole markings and a few cup marks. In addition, they found a rock surface with 3 delicate motifs of boats, and one rock surface with three distinctly carved motifs of boats. |
